Seller and scope
AUTOLIFT PRODUCTION s.r.o. (“AUTOLIFT”), registered office Příkop 838/6, 602 00 Brno, Czech Republic, Company ID 04741269, is the contracting seller for the storefronts listed below.
This policy applies to AUTOLIFT’s English-language EU storefronts for Belgium, Cyprus, Denmark, Estonia, Spain, Finland, France, Croatia, Hungary, Ireland, Lithuania, Luxembourg, Latvia, the Netherlands, Poland, Portugal, Romania, Sweden, Slovenia, and Slovakia. It does not apply to Bulgaria, the United Kingdom, Switzerland, Canada, or the United States.
This policy covers statutory Consumer withdrawal and AUTOLIFT’s additional voluntary return offer for eligible non-defective goods. Defective, damaged, incomplete, incorrect, or otherwise non-conforming goods are handled under the Warranty, Defects & Claims section of the applicable Terms & Conditions.
Consumer right to withdraw within 14 days
A Consumer may withdraw from a qualifying distance purchase without giving a reason within 14 days after the Consumer, or a person designated by the Consumer other than the carrier, receives the goods. Where one order is delivered in multiple parts, the applicable period begins when the last qualifying part is received.
To exercise this right, the Consumer must send AUTOLIFT a clear statement of the decision to withdraw before the 14-day period ends. Contact: info@autoliftproduction.com. The Consumer may use a legally required model withdrawal form where applicable, but an unambiguous statement is sufficient unless mandatory law requires another method.
After notifying AUTOLIFT, the Consumer must send the goods back without undue delay and no later than 14 days after giving notice. The Consumer is responsible for the direct cost of the return unless AUTOLIFT agreed otherwise or mandatory law places that cost on AUTOLIFT.
AUTOLIFT will reimburse payments required by mandatory withdrawal law, including the cost of the least expensive standard outbound-delivery option offered for the order. Any additional amount paid for a premium delivery option need not be reimbursed where applicable law permits that treatment. Reimbursement is made using the original payment method unless the Consumer expressly agrees otherwise and incurs no fee as a result.
Reimbursement must be made without undue delay and no later than 14 days after AUTOLIFT is informed of the withdrawal. AUTOLIFT may withhold reimbursement until it receives the goods or the Consumer supplies evidence of dispatch, whichever occurs first, where applicable law permits this.
The Consumer is responsible only for diminished value resulting from handling beyond what is necessary to establish the nature, characteristics, and functioning of the goods. The stricter unused-product conditions below apply only to the additional voluntary offer and do not restrict statutory withdrawal or defect rights.
Additional voluntary 30-day returns
In addition to mandatory rights, Consumers and Business Buyers may return eligible non-defective goods under this voluntary offer by contacting AUTOLIFT no later than 30 calendar days after delivery and meeting the conditions below.
This voluntary offer applies to current standard and promotional products unless an applicable offer expressly states an exception. The current catalogue has no personalized or made-to-order products. Future product or promotion exceptions must be disclosed before purchase.
Starting and sending a voluntary return
Contact info@autoliftproduction.com before sending the goods and include the order or invoice number, product, and contact details. Wait for suitable carrier, handling, and destination instructions before sending heavy equipment.
After contacting AUTOLIFT, send the goods without undue delay and no later than 14 calendar days after that initial contact, using a suitable carrier or freight service in accordance with AUTOLIFT’s instructions.

Voluntary returns are made by carrier or freight service, not in store. The Buyer pays ordinary voluntary-return freight. This offer does not provide a fixed return fee or prepaid return label. This rule does not determine freight for a valid defective or incorrect-goods claim.
Condition and proof for the voluntary offer
To qualify for the additional voluntary offer, goods must be unused, complete, undamaged, without signs of use, and in undamaged original packaging. A signed original invoice or delivery note must be provided.
These voluntary conditions do not restrict mandatory withdrawal, defect, or warranty rights.
Refund under the voluntary offer
For a return accepted under the voluntary offer, AUTOLIFT refunds 100% of the product purchase price. There is no restocking fee or other fixed or percentage deduction from that product price. The Buyer pays ordinary return freight.
Original outbound delivery is not refunded for voluntary Consumer returns during days 15–30. This does not change the standard outbound-delivery reimbursement required for a valid statutory Consumer withdrawal.
Refunds are made using the original payment method. AUTOLIFT processes a qualifying voluntary-return refund within 14 calendar days after receiving the returned goods and completes its inspection within that same period.
Exchanges and other outcomes
This policy does not provide an exchange, store credit, seasonal extension, or out-of-stock replacement.
